Errors in textbook: Complete probe by March 5, says Pargat Singh

Show comments

Tribune News Service

Chandigarh, February 27

Education Minister Pargat Singh has directed to complete an inquiry related to alleged errors and discrepancies in history books of Classes XI and XII of the Punjab School Education Board by March 5.

A six-member oversight committee constituted in 2018 had said that the facts were “distorted in the books, particularly with use of wrong language”. —
